Output 3d1564617a76df605e1c38fefff5b00fb6cc3e7df33582561aec0077e62d2131:0

value
1118183
script pubkey
OP_0 OP_PUSHBYTES_20 e6c031de108728e5070effe09bf13b5ac579a461
address
bc1qumqrrhsssu5w2pcwllsfhufmttzhnfrprqew2h
transaction
3d1564617a76df605e1c38fefff5b00fb6cc3e7df33582561aec0077e62d2131
confirmations
11024
spent
true